Google My Business: Google My Business is a free online tool provided by Google that helps small business owners manage their online presence. It allows businesses to create and optimize their business profiles on Google, which can appear in Google Search and Maps. With Google My Business, owners can update their contact information, hours of operation, add photos, respond to customer reviews, and even post updates or promotions. It is a valuable resource for increasing visibility, attracting local customers, and managing online reputation. For example, a small bakery can use Google My Business to showcase their menu, share customer reviews, and provide directions for potential customers searching for bakeries in their area.

Google Sites: Google Sites is a free website-building platform offered by Google. It enables small business owners to create simple, visually appealing websites without any coding knowledge. With an intuitive drag-and-drop interface, users can easily add text, images, videos, and other content to their website. Google Sites offers various customization options, including templates, themes, and the ability to personalize the site's layout. It is an excellent tool for small businesses to establish an online presence, create a professional website, and share important information with customers. For instance, a boutique clothing store can use Google Sites to showcase their latest collections, provide contact details, and display store location and hours.

Google Search Console: Google Search Console is a free web service provided by Google that allows small business owners to monitor and optimize their website's performance in Google Search results. It provides valuable insights about how Google indexes and crawls their website, alerts them to any issues or errors, and offers suggestions to improve search visibility. Small business owners can monitor their website's search traffic, identify keywords that drive visitors to their site, and analyze the performance of specific pages. For example, an online bookstore can use Google Search Console to identify popular search queries related to books and optimize their website content accordingly to attract more organic traffic.

Google Trends: Google Trends is a free online tool that provides insights into the popularity and interest of specific search terms over time. It allows small business owners to understand trends and consumer behavior, enabling them to make informed decisions about their marketing strategies. With Google Trends, owners can explore search trends by region, compare the popularity of different keywords, and identify rising or seasonal interests. For example, a gift shop owner can use Google Trends to identify popular gift ideas during the holiday season and adjust their inventory accordingly to meet customer demand.

Unsplash: Unsplash is a popular platform that offers a vast collection of high-quality, royalty-free images. It is a valuable resource for small business owners who are looking for visually appealing and engaging visuals to enhance their marketing materials, website, social media posts, and other promotional content. Unsplash provides a wide range of professional photographs contributed by talented photographers worldwide. Small business owners can search and download images for free, saving them time and money in sourcing visual content. For example, a coffee shop owner can use Unsplash to find captivating images of coffee, cozy interiors, or latte art to enhance their social media posts and attract customers visually.
